What industrial facilities are nearby the property?
Wingfield is primarily an industrial suburb, with recycling, manufacturing and freight forwarding operations nearby. The 94‑hectare Wingfield Waste & Recycling Centre (Wingfield Tip) is a prominent facility in the area.
Are there any recreational or sporting venues close to the house?
Yes, the Sidewinders Speedway, Australia’s only dedicated junior motorcycle speedway track, is about 1.2 km away in the Wingfield Reserve. This venue offers local motorsport activities for the community.
